What is Blepharoplasty?

Blepharoplasty, commonly known as eyelid surgery, is a surgical procedure that removes excess skin, fat, and muscle from the upper and/or lower eyelids. The goal is to create a more youthful, alert appearance while improving vision in cases where sagging eyelids obstruct sight.

Advancements in Blepharoplasty Techniques

With ongoing cosmetic and reconstructive surgery developments, blepharoplasty has evolved to offer more precise, natural, and longer-lasting results. Here are some of the latest advancements:

1. Laser-Assisted Blepharoplasty

Traditional eyelid surgery involves the use of a scalpel, but modern techniques now utilise laser technology to make incisions.

2. Scarless (Transconjunctival) Blepharoplasty

For patients undergoing lower eyelid surgery, surgeons can now perform a scarless technique by making incisions inside the eyelid rather than on the skin.

3. Fat Repositioning and Preservation

Previously, excess fat was simply removed from the eyelids, but modern approaches focus on redistributing or preserving fat to prevent a hollow or sunken look.
